Coolant temperature warning light “”
If the coolant temperature reaches a specified lev-
el, this light comes on to warn that the coolant tem-
perature is too hot. If the light comes on during
operation, stop the engine as soon as it is safe to
do so and allow the engine to cool down for about
10 minutes. (See page 8-154.)
The electrical circuit of the warning light can be
checked by turning the key to “ON”. If the warning
light does not come on, have a Yamaha dealer
check the electrical circuit.NOTICE
The engine may overheat if the vehicle is
overloaded. If this happens, reduce the load
to specification.
After restarting, make sure that the light is
out. Continuous use while the light is on
may cause damage to the engine.

The air filter element should be cleaned every 20–
40 hours. It should be cleaned and lubricated
more often if the vehicle is operated in extremely
dusty areas. Each time air filter element mainte-
nance is performed, check the air inlet to the air fil-
ter case for obstructions. Check the air filter
element rubber joint to the throttle body and mani-
fold fittings for an airtight seal. Tighten all fittings
securely to avoid the possibility of unfiltered air en-
tering the engine.NOTICE
Never operate the engine with the air filter ele-
ment removed. This will allow unfiltered air to
enter, causing rapid engine wear and possible
engine damage. Additionally, operation with-
out the air filter element will affect the fuel in-
jection system with subsequent poor
performance and possible engine overheating.

Engine overheating
Wait for the engine to cool before removing the radiator cap. WARNING! If the engine is not cool when
removing the radiator cap, hot fluid and steam could blow out under pressure and burn you. Place
a thick rag over the cap and remove the cap slowly to allow any remaining pressure to escape.
If it is difficult to get the recommended coolant, tap water can be used temporarily, provided that it is
changed to the recommended coolant as soon as possible.Wait until the
engine has cooled.
